What on earth is Grey Divorce?

Gray divorce refers to the phenomenon of couples separating or divorcing in their later on years, commonly once the age of 50. The time period "grey" alludes into the graying hair That always accompanies growing older. These divorces usually come about after very long-term marriages of 20, 30, or even 40+ yrs, generally shocking family and friends who assumed the few would continue being alongside one another for life. Grey divorces may perhaps materialize once youngsters have left property, right after retirement, or as partners realize they have developed apart about a long time collectively.

As opposed to divorces amongst young partners, grey divorces involve unique factors together with retirement cost savings, Medicare Added benefits, Social Safety, estate arranging, and health issues that become more and more significant as individuals age. The emotional affect can also vary, as these people have typically designed full Grownup lives intertwined with their spouse.

The Growing Prevalence of Gray Divorce in America

Gray divorce has grown to be ever more common in The us over the past many many years. Though the overall divorce fee has stabilized or simply declined marginally recently, the rate among the Grownups aged 50 and more mature has around doubled Considering that the 1990s.

As outlined by analysis from your Pew Investigation Heart, the divorce amount for Americans aged 50 and older tripled from 1990 to 2015, and for the people 65 and more mature, it greater fivefold in the exact same time period. This development has continued recently, with about one particular in 4 divorces now occurring amongst couples aged 50 and more mature.

Elements Contributing to the Gray Divorce Trend

Amplified Longevity

Americans are living extended than ever just before. When partners marry of their 20s or 30s, they now perhaps experience 50-60 decades together rather then the 30-40 several years that former generations might need envisioned. This prolonged timeline means more chance for interactions to evolve or deteriorate eventually.

Baby Boomer Attitudes

The child boomer generation has historically maintained larger divorce rates in the course of all stages of their lives compared to past generations. This technology introduced much more liberal views about individual fulfillment and less rigid adherence to tradition.

Reduced Social Stigma

Divorce no more carries the social stigma it after did. Prior generations might need remained in unhappy marriages because of religious beliefs, loved ones force, or Group expectations. Modern older Grownups really feel extra independence to go after pleasure even afterwards in life.

Money Independence

Particularly for Gals, greater workforce participation and lifetime earnings have presented the economical suggests to aid them selves write-up-divorce. This economic independence gets rid of an important barrier that saved lots of former generations in unsatisfying marriages.

Bigger Expectations for Relationship

Present day partners often hope far more psychological fulfillment, companionship, and personal expansion from their marriages than earlier generations. When these expectations usually are not met, divorce results in being far more likely, even immediately after many years collectively.

Empty Nest Syndrome

When little ones depart residence, partners all of a sudden deal with each other with no buffer and shared purpose that youngster-rearing presented. This transition reveals romantic relationship difficulties that were previously masked by busy family schedules and parenting obligations.

Pandemic Affect

The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ated several grey divorces, as prolonged time in shut quarters pressured partners to confront romance concerns that they had previously been ready in order to avoid via fast paced schedules and time aside. The existential queries elevated throughout this period prompted a lot of to reevaluate their priorities and associations.

Psychological Effects and Skilled Guidance

Grey divorce makes unique psychological challenges that vary from All those experienced by young people today. Older Older people under-going divorce usually face:



Loss of identification soon after decades of being Element of a couple

Stress and anxiety about financial safety in retirement years

Concern of aging on your own and fears about foreseeable future caregiving

Grief over the lack of shared desires for retirement

Social isolation as Close friend groups typically split or just take sides

Strained associations with adult youngsters who may well battle to accept the divorce



How Psychologists Can Help Navigate Gray Divorce

Psychologists offer important assist for people suffering from grey divorce by means of various evidence-dependent approaches:

Particular person Therapy

A psychologist can offer a safe Area for processing elaborate thoughts which includes grief, anger, reduction, and stress and anxiety.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) aids persons identify damaging imagined designs and acquire much healthier Views on this big lifestyle transition. Mindfulness-primarily based ways could also enable regulate worry and psychological reactivity all through this turbulent time.

Specialised Grief Operate

Gray divorce frequently involves substantial grief over the lack of not only the connection but will also long run strategies, traditions, and a single's identity as Component of a few. Psychologists trained in grief do the job can information people through this exceptional type of reduction, acknowledging which the conclude of the decades-very long relationship represents a number of levels of grief that need to be processed.

Simple Changeover Support

Over and above psychological processing, psychologists can assist with sensible areas of rebuilding life after a extended marriage. This incorporates developing new social connections, making meaningful routines, and obtaining intent On this new chapter. Many of us need assistance in redefining on their own and setting up a fresh identity separate from their previous job as a wife or husband. Psychologists can offer structured direction for these functional issues.

Household Therapy Possibilities

Psychologists can facilitate difficult discussions with adult children who may battle to accept their parents' divorce. These periods aid maintain vital family members bonds during the transition and forestall unneeded estrangement. Family more info members therapy results in a structured surroundings where all associates can Categorical their feelings even though preserving important associations all through this changeover.

Assistance Groups

Quite a few psychologists guide assistance groups specifically for gray divorce, letting individuals to connect with Other individuals experiencing similar difficulties. These groups minimize isolation and provide viewpoint on navigating this existence transition. The shared knowledge of age-distinct divorce results in highly effective bonds and simple knowledge that specific therapy on your own can not supply.
